Peter lynch books.

Peter Lynch managed the Fidelity Magellan Fund from 1977 to 1990 when it was one of the most successful mutual-funds of all time. He then became a vice chairman at Fidelity and more recently has become a prominent philanthropist particularly active in the Boston area. His books include One Up on Wall Street, Beating the Street, and Learn to Earn (all written with John Rothchild).

It makes sense that people would recommend Learn to Earn as the first of Lynch’s books to read. It begins with an introduction to the history of capitalism and slides into the fundamentals of personal finance and investing, which even older kids in high school can benefit from. Peter Lynch had an atypical profile on Wall Street. In college, he mostly studied history, psychology, and political science. His investing returns were atypical as well. While 60% of money managers struggle to just beat the indexes, Peter Lynch achieved a 29.2% average gain.
